Output bfbf2afcb229ec7e1056887a18fafaa179c893034c59c5e29ad477ed8509a990:17

value
830948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e8a66225ddda5fd3b29e599140c2dfa784a2b17 OP_EQUAL
address
331uBMi1PPsDV7Roeyv5ET4cHNPh3vZ4Rf
transaction
bfbf2afcb229ec7e1056887a18fafaa179c893034c59c5e29ad477ed8509a990
confirmations
262813
spent
true